Norwegian state-owned energy giant Equinor is retaining Aker Solutions, a compatriot player, as its inspection services provider across more than 15 onshore and offshore facilities in Norway, thanks to a multi-year contract extension.
This four-year contract extension, which is said to follow Equinor’s decision to exercise an option included in the current agreement, will enable Aker Solutions to continue to deliver inspection services across over 15 operating facilities in Norway, starting from January 1, 2026. The assignment will be carried out by the company’s personnel in Stavanger, Bergen, and Trondheim.
